    Default Weihrauch HW97K advise

    Afternoon gents.

    Need some advise from air rifle shooters.

    I have just purchased the above mentioned rifle.

    I consistently shoot R5 sized 10 shot groups at 30m.
    I feel that the rifle should shoot better. Is this rifle a better shooter than that or is that group size representative of the rifle?

    I have tried 4 different pellet brands. rifle prefers heavier pellets it seems as the diablo match monster gives me the best results.

    Default Re: Weihrauch HW97K advise

    There are one or two members here that might give you some better advice, but I shot that rifle in competition for a while, so here goes:

    1. It's a springer. It wants to be resting in your hand, not on a bench or bench rest.
    2. Springs and top hats break. I had to replace at least one of the two every 2000 shots.
    3. It's hard on 'scopes. Check that you have the right one. For air rifles.
    4. Heavy pellets are not the answer. But premium pellets are. JSB and Air Arms worked for me. If you want a few to test, I might have left that I could bring to Witbank.
    4. Practice, practice and practice. The main problem with this rifle is not the rifle. It's the mutt behind the butt.

    Enjoy, it really is fun when you get it right. And a R5 coin at 30m is not bad. 50mm ad 50m is the standard.

    Default Re: Weihrauch HW97K advise

    You say they dont like a bench. Whats the reason for that. Does it have to do with how it recoils?

    Default Re: Weihrauch HW97K advise

    Yes, remember there are two bumps with a springer. Once when you pull the trigger when the spring starts moving forward and then again when it hits the front of the tube. For some reason it is really difficult to keep that constant off the bench. In my experience, anyway.

    Default Re: Weihrauch HW97K advise

    What caliber HW97K and pellet weights are you using? I group about 1-1.5 cm at 30M off the bench no problem and all day long. There may be other issues to consider like the following:
    1) Have you cleaned the barrel as there is lots of rubbish in a new air rifle barrel?
    2) Are you pulling the air rifle stock into your sholder hard? If so don't
    3) Support the stock with an open flat hand, dont grip the fore part of the stock
    4) Squeese the trigger, dont pull
    5) Follow through on all shots
    6) Are you looking directly down the centre of the scope for each shot, this can make a huge difference
    7) Did you zero the scope at max magnification as this is best
